If Ash Grove was feeling good fresh off their 14-4 takedown of Marionville last Thursday, their most recent game may have dampened their spirits a bit. The Pirates fell just short of the Mansfield Lions by a score of 8-7 on Tuesday. Ty Messley was cooking despite his team's loss, scoring a run while going 3-for-4. The team also got some help courtesy of Alex Acosta, who scored three runs and stole two bases while going 1-for-4.
Ash Grove's defeat dropped their record down to 2-2. As for Mansfield, they now have a winning record of 3-2.
Both teams will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Ash Grove will face off against New Heights Christian Academy at 5:00 p.m. on Thursday. As for Mansfield, they will venture away from home to face off against Ava at 4:30 p.m. on Thursday.
